What is a Battery Isolator?

A battery isolator is a device used to protect the battery of a vehicle from overcharging and discharging. This device is typically used in applications such as RV and marine batteries, where multiple batteries are used in the same system. The battery isolator helps to ensure that each battery is being charged properly and that the system is not being overcharged or discharged, which can lead to major electrical issues.

Reading a Wiring Diagram

Reading a wiring diagram for a battery isolator isn’t as difficult as it may seem. The diagram will typically include labels for each of the components in the system, such as the battery, alternator, isolator, and voltage regulator. The diagram will also include arrows to indicate the direction of the current flow. By understanding the labels and the direction of the current flow, it is possible to determine how the components are connected and how the system should be wired.
